The invention relates to a pneumatic working cylinder with pneumatic end-position damping In order to dampen the piston movement in a working cylinder as uniformly as possible before the end position is reached, a longitudinal bore (21) and several transverse bores (20) connected to the longitudinal bore (21) are provided, as shown in Fig. 1, in a damping piston (7) arranged coaxially on the main piston (4). When the damping piston (7) plunges into a damping space (blind hole 9) provided with a sealing element, the longitudinal bore (21) and the transverse bores (20), after crossing the sealing element, gradually connect the damping space (9) to the working chamber to be vented. High pressure peaks in the damping space and thus uncontrolled spring-back of the damping piston (7) and thus also of the main piston (4) are prevented by this measure. <IMAGE>
